Role/ Department:
Graphics Designer/Talent Management
The Key Responsibilities Of The Role Include:Conceptualize and create engaging designs and presentations for executive level audience.Translate concepts and ideas into compelling visual designs that effectively communicate information to the intended audience.Work with cross-functional teams to incorporate feedback and iterate on designs.Prioritize and manage multiple projects.Ensure projects are completed with high quality and on schedule.Work with a wide range of media and use graphic design software.Design and produce graphic materials, such as charts, presentations, brochures, ads, cartoons, etc., utilizing computer graphics software or traditional production and design methods as appropriate.Advise team on the most effective use of graphic communications.
Skills/ Qualifications:Bachelor's degree in graphic arts, design, communications, or related field.3-5 years of proven experience in graphic design in a corporate environment.Excellent communication, collaboration, and problem-solving skills.Ability to work independently or as part of a team.Strong analytical skills.Excellent eye for detail and visual composition.Highly proficient in PowerPoint and other graphic design software.
